The 2026 Onua-Atena Community League will be heading into the final zonal fixtures on Saturday, August 22 after qualifiers from Zone B and Zone C were determined over the weekend.

After Lashibi Community 13 and Aworshia Movement (Anglican FC) made it on the opening day, from Zone A, there was two-day continuous action at the La McDan Park for Zone B and Zone D.

Majesty Stars and Dansoman Glefe’s Dynamic Boyz began it all. After a goalless draw, the game went straight to penalties, won 2-1 by Majesty Stars.

Defending champions Ashaiman Revelations made it 1-0 over Amasaman Goal Soccer Academy to progress, setting up a play-off against Majesty Stars.

The third game saw Ga Mashie America Palace progress with a 1-0 win over Ashaiman Freetown while the final match in the first round saw La Coastal United secure a 4-2 shoot-out win over Old Ashongman.

This set up a derby between Ga Mashie and La Coastal United in the play-offs for the quarter-finals.

Before that game, Ashaiman Revelations cruised to a 2-0 win to book their place.

The much-anticipated derby between Ga Mashie and La Coastal Utd ended goalless but the latter emerged 5-4 winners of the marathon penalty shootouts.

A protest raised by Ga Mashie saw organisers hold on in declaring La Coastal Utd outright winners.

On Sunday, August 16, South La Estates lost on penalties to Ashongman Ashville FC after a goalless game.

Tema Community 2 Vision Stars made it 2-0 over John Teye while Tema Comm. 25 (Future Gem) also made it 2-0 over Sakumono Comm. 13.

There was pure entertainment for fans at the La McDan Park as Madina Redco slugged it out with Labone Heroes. It ended 2-1 in favour of the neighbourhood side.

In the play-offs for the two tickets to the quarter-finals, scheduled for Sunday, August 23, Ashville FC beat Tema Comm. 2 by 2-1 while Labone Heroes won 3-2 on penalties after a goalless draw against Tema Comm. 25.

All the qualifiers to the quarter finals receive a cash of GH¢1,000 from Atena NLA as part of preparations.
